According to the public record, 2 Chapmans Close, Oxford is a early-century freehold house with 1,722 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 583 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 2 Chapmans Close, Oxford is £737,819 and the estimated rental value is £2,605 per month.

2 Chapmans Close, Oxford has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 29 Dec 2016.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, oil.
According to HM Land Registry, 2 Chapmans Close, Oxford was last sold on 20th November 2017 for £645,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
